Location

This hotel is located at the centre of Piraeus next to Terpsitheas Square Gardens. It lies in a business area, very close to the main port of Piraeus and to the commercial area. The hotel is also very close to Pasalimani harbour (300 m), which is full of restaurants and cafés. Piraeus' archaeological museum is just 300 m from the hotel and Marina Zeas, with its bars and pubs, is 500 m away, as is the Nautical Museum of Piraeus. Within walking distance of the hotel guests will find a bus stop, train station and museums. It is 2.5 km to Votsalakia Beach and 7 km to Mikrolimano, Athens. Athens Airport is 40 km away.

Facility

The hotel has 8 single rooms and 72 double rooms, which are located on 8 storeys and are reachable by lift. Guests are warmly welcomed by English-speaking staff at the 24-hour reception desk in the lobby. Check-in/check-out service is available round the clock. Amenities include a baggage storage service, a safe and a currency exchange service. Wireless internet access allows guests to stay connected while on holiday. The tour desk offers assistance with booking excursions. There are a number of shops as well. A garden provides extra space for rest and relaxation in the open air. Additional facilities include a TV room. Guests arriving by car can park their vehicles in the garage or in the car park (for a fee). Further services and facilities include a babysitting service, a car hire service, room service (for a fee), a laundry service and a coin-operated laundry. Travellers with bicycles can make use of the on-site bicycle storage area. The business centre is on hand for guests' business requirements and provides a fax machine.

Rooms

Air conditioning and individually adjustable heating ensure that rooms maintain comfortable temperatures. Guests can enjoy the garden view from a balcony or terrace. Rooms have a double bed or a queen-size bed. Extra beds can be requested. A safe and a minibar are also available. Additional features include a refrigerator, a mini fridge and a tea/coffee station. An ironing set is provided for guests' convenience. A direct dial telephone, a television with satellite/cable channels, a radio and WiFi are provided as well. A hairdryer and a telephone are available in the bathrooms, which are equipped with a shower and a bathtub. Wheelchair-friendly rooms can be booked. The hotel has family rooms, non-smoking rooms and smoking rooms.

Sport

Fine weather can be enjoyed on the terrace. A wellness area with massage treatments is available at the hotel. Parents can unwind while the kids can participate in an entertainment programme full of fun activities.

Meals

Various dining options are available, including a dining room, a breakfast room, a café and a bar. A number of specialities await guests in the air-conditioned, non-smoking restaurant. Catering options include bed and breakfast, half board and full board. A continental breakfast buffet guarantees a great start to the day. For lunch and dinner, guests can order à la carte.

Payment

The following credit cards are accepted: American Express, VISA, Diners Club and MasterCard.

    Stayed here midweek for four nights (Monday to Thursday) for work in July. I really don't recognise this hotel from the bad reviews on here so can only assume it's under new ownership/management.I had a superior single booked but was given a twin so it was a decent size for one but might have been a little cramped for two people. The room had a balcony but was so high on the 7th floor that I didn't use it as I'm not great with heights. The room also had great air con and thankfully a small fridge. I had four great nights' sleep so the hotel was obviously quiet (although I believe from the students who I was supervising and stayed for a fortnight it can be noisy at weekends).It's not perfect: the tea at breakfast is (like most hotels in Europe) awful, there is not a massive choice of food at breakfast and the rooms don't have a kettle (I would take a travel kettle if you want a tea/coffee as it was an absolute godsend) but overall I was pleasantly surprised as there was little choice of hotels as we booked late. There seemed to be a smell of smoke in my room one night which I can only assume came from the room next door and the advertised roof top terrace was not available as it looked like it was being refurbished. It's not in a great area for tourists but there are plenty of restaurants, takeaways and bakeries within walking distance and the nearby curry house is very good value.The hotel is 10-15 minute walk from the Piraeus metro station and then a further 30 minutes or so to Athens' main attractions so I would allow 45-60 mins to get from the hotel to the touristy bits (I think there are buses that go some/all the way but I never worked this out as the metro seemed easy enough) A special thanks to Mario who got me some fresh milk from the kitchen on the night I arrived late. Also the cleaner was friendly and did a great job and we we were allowed to leave our luggage at reception on the day we left (we had a late flight back)Overall a great stay for what we charged. I would thoroughly recommend and with a couple of minor improvements this could be a great budget option. I might be a bit more critical if it was my own money I had been spending but still I had a really comfortable and peaceful stay.
